Today continues my week of ideas for using Stampin' Up! fall products in simple, new ways or, in the case of the card above, giving one of my favorite stamps (the tree from Forever Young) a fall makeover.
- The Crumb Cake card base was cut to 4 1/4" x 8 1/2. It's scored at 3" to create the front panel.
- The More Mustard tree layer measures 3 1/2" x 3 1/8". The Early Espresso mat is 1"4 larger.
- Yummy! New to the Stampin' Up! Holiday Catalog is Early Espresso Stampin' Emboss Powder. So rich layered on More Mustard. I stamped both the tree and sentiment and then embossed.
- Make a statement. I added a Stampin' Up! Antique Brad to the tree for an instant WOW! factor.
